Like its early-’70s ancestor, this model combines classic Telecaster bite with the thicker voice of a humbucker. Specifically, it pairs a traditional single-coil bridge pickup with a powerful Fender Wide Range humbucking neck pickup. As a result, players get bright attack in the bridge position and warm, rounded tones at the neck.
The alder body delivers balanced resonance and focused mids. Meanwhile, the maple neck features a comfortable “C” profile for smooth playability. In addition, the three-bolt neck plate with Micro-Tilt™ adjustment allows precise setup control. The 7.25″radius fingerboard and 21 vintage-style frets further reinforce the authentic vintage feel.
Tonally, this configuration is highly versatile. The bridge pickup cuts through a mix with clarity and snap. By contrast, the neck humbucker provides higher output and thicker harmonic content. Because each pickup has dedicated volume and tone controls, fine adjustments are quick and intuitive. A three-way toggle on the upper shoulder ensures practical switching during performance.

Wide Range Humbucking Pickup
The Modern Wide Range humbucking pickup evokes the look and tone of Fender’s early-1970s design. Therefore, it delivers increased output while retaining clarity and articulation.

Three-Saddle American Vintage Telecaster Bridge
With authentic design and performance inspired by Telecasters of the 1950s, ’60s, and ’70s, this model features an American Vintage Telecaster bridge with three saddles.

’70s-Style “F” Tuners
This specialized Fender Classic ’72 Telecaster model features sealed tuners stamped with the stylized capital “F” from the classic Fender script logo.
